Unintentionally hilarious CGI bears on ABC's 'Station 19' had fans losing it on Twitter

On the Grey's Anatomy spinoff Station 19 Thursday, what started off as a team-building camping trip soon turned into a full on crisis, when two nearby campers were gruesomely attacked by a bear. However, while it sounds like the scene was terrifying, it was actually sort of hilarious due to poor CGI, and viewers could bear-ly handle it.

Fortunately for the crew, none of them suffered the same fate as Leonardo DiCaprio circa The Revenant, as Andy managed to instruct the crew on how to handle the bear until it eventually ran off. However, unfortunately for the two campers, the husband, who had jumped in front of his wife in an attempt to save her from the bear, lost his nose and, later, his life during Grey's Anatomy, the second hour of ABC's crossover event.

Station 19 airs Thursdays at 8 p.m. on ABC.
